MULTIPLE BURGLARIES OF A LABADIEVILLE RELIGIOUS INSTITUTION – MALE JUVENILE – AGE 13
LABADIEVILLE – Assumption Parish Sheriff Leland Falcon reports the filing of a verified complaint against a 13-year-old male juvenile from Gonzales in connection with multiple burglaries of a religious institution located in the 100 block of Convent Street in Labadieville.
On April 1, 2024, deputies responded to the location in reference to a burglary. Detectives responded and initiated an investigation. It was determined that an unknown individual (s) made forced entry into a building and stole items from within.
On April 4, 2024, the Sheriff’s Office was notified of another burglary at the same building but in a separate area of the facility. Again, the suspect (s) made forced entry into the building and stole goods valued at over $1,000. Deputies were able to recover some of the stolen property.
Detectives continued their investigation and were able to develop a 13-year-old male from Gonzales as a suspect.
At the conclusion of the investigation, the 13-year-old male suspect was charged by verified complaint with 2 counts of Simple Burglary.
The juvenile was released to a guardian pending judicial proceedings.
